Groenekan is located in the province of Utrecht, in the municipality of De Bilt The district has a total area of 1.214 hectares, of which 1.178 hectares are land and 37 hectares are water. The district is coded as WK031004. The postcode area is 3737AA-3737XC.
Groenekan has 1.960 residents. Of these, 51,5% are men and 48,5% are women. Most residents are 45 to 65 years (32,9%). The other age groups are 18,1% for '65 years or older', 17,1% for '25 to 45 years', 16,8% for '0 to 15 years' and 14,8% for '15 to 25 years'. Of the residents, 49,0% is unmarried, 41,8% is married, 5,4% is divorced and 4,1% is widowed. 1.680 residents originate from the Netherlands, 130 come from Europe and 145 come from countries outside Europe.
There are 785 households in Groenekan. 28,7% of these are single-person households, 29,9% households without children and 41,4% households with children. The average household size is 2,5 persons.
In Groenekan there are 1.600 income recipients. The average income per income recipient is €50.600, which is €14.800 (41%) higher than the national average of €35.800. Per resident, the average income is €40.000, which is €10.800 (37%) higher than the national average of €29.200. Most residents of Groenekan are highly educated. 55,4% have a university or higher professional education (HBO/WO), 25,7% have an intermediate education (HAVO, VWO or MBO 2-4) and 18,9% have a lower education (VMBO or MBO 1).
Of the 1.960 residents, around 72% are in paid employment, which amounts to 1.411 people. This is 7% higher than the national average of 65%. The majority of workers are in salaried employment (68%), while 32% are self-employed. In Groenekan, 18% of residents receive a benefit. The largest group is those receiving a state pension (AOW). 310 people receive this benefit.
In Groenekan there are 746 homes with an average assessed value (WOZ) of €770.000. Of these, around 95% are occupied and 5% unoccupied. Most homes are owner-occupied. This amounts to 14% rental homes and 86% owner-occupied homes. Of the homes, 87% privately owned, 3% owned by housing associations and 10% owned by other landlords. The most common construction periods in Groenekan are 1950-1970 (27%) and 1925-1950 (25%).

In Groenekan there are 790 addresses with a registered energy label. The most common labels are G (33%), F (19%) and C (13%). On average, an address in Groenekan uses 3.870 kWh of electricity per year. This is 38% above the national average of 2.810 kWh. Natural gas consumption, at 1.700 m³ per year, is 33% above the national average of 1.280 m³.
The housing stock is mainly post-war — 55% was built between 1945 and 1990.
